What to Do When Your Fiat 500 Key Fob Stops Working

There are several options available when your Fiat 500 keyfob has stopped working. You could try replacing the coin battery, reprogramming it or asking a locksmith for assistance.

A dead battery for a coin is the most common reason for the key fob to not work. It is easy to replace it with a fresh battery.

Keyless entry

It's important to keep in mind that even though keyless entry is convenient, it can't substitute for a physical key. To start the engine, you require a key-fob with a working battery. If the battery of the key fob fails or is damaged it could cause problems with the remote. You'll need to replace the key if it is lost.

The chip in the key fob contains a red-key or crypto-key coding system that communicates with the immobiliser in your vehicle to unlock and start. It also transmits an electronic signal to the central locking system, which allows you to open the doors and trunk without having to use your key.

If the battery in the key fob is depleted the signal it sends to the central locking system or the infotainment system in the vehicle will be lost. The first thing to do is to replace the battery. Make sure that the new battery has the same voltage as that of the old. Make sure that the metal clips holding the battery are not loose, as this could cause damage to the internal circuit.

Water damage is a common reason for an unresponsive or dead key fob. While the key fob is equipped with rubber seals long-term exposure to soapy or salty water could damage the electronics. If this happens, you should remove the battery from the key fob and clean it with isopropyl ethanol and paper towels.

Ignition Cylinder

The ignition cylinder, also known as the key lock cylinder, is a vital car part which keeps your vehicle secure and safe. Many vehicles on the road still use traditional ignition cylinders, even though the majority of newer vehicles have keyless and push button power and start systems. The ignition cylinder is a mechanical tumbler that your key slides into. Your car will not start in the event that the tumblers have worn out or are failing. The pins inside the cylinder are usually worn out. One of the signs is that the key becomes difficult to turn or could not be able to get into the ignition in any way.

Some people have managed to repair worn-out cylinders using graphite or WD-40 but these solutions are not permanent and will not fix the issue in the long run. The best solution to your car's problem is to replace the cylinder housing of the ignition. This is a simple DIY project which you can complete in just a few steps.

Before starting the task, disconnect and isolate the negative battery cable to avoid electrical shorts. Also, refer to the factory repair manual for your particular vehicle. This will help you to prevent any problems that may arise with the airbag system, or the Supplemental Retard System. Also, be aware that replacing the cylinder's housing may require removal of components that could disrupt the airbag or SIR system.
